deepeeka gladiator helmet thraex Emmers - meubels en interieur The original dates from theThe thraex was a gladiator who was armed in the Thracian manner, with a small square shield, the parmula, and a short sword with a slightly curved blade, the sica, which was intended to cut the unprotected back of the opponent. He also wore a protector for his sword arm and shoulder, shin protectors, a broad belt, and a helm with a plume, a visor, and a high crest for protection.
